Purchasing Agent Intern DEPARTMENT: 5SC200 Purchasing MGD REPORTS TO: Supervisor Purchasing CLASSIFICATION: Hourly (Non-Exempt) SHIFT: 1st Shift SHIFT DIFFERENTIAL: No PAY GRADE: 3 SCHEDULE: 7:00 AM - 4:00 PM 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ES: Purchase materials, supplies, and components to support production and operational needs Communicate with vendors regarding pricing, lead times, and order status Create and manage purchase orders in the company ERP system Monitor inventory levels and help prevent material shortages or overstock situations Track deliveries and follow up on late or missing shipments Maintain accurate purchasing records and supplier information Support cost reduction and supplier improvement initiatives Coordinate with production, warehouse, and accounting teams to ensure smooth material flow Assist in evaluating supplier performance related to quality, pricing, and delivery Ensure purchased materials meet company quality and specification requirements Other duties may be assigned. QUALIFICATIONS: Ability to work independently and as part of a team. Ability to prioritize tasks.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Outlook, PowerPoint) Great interpersonal skills are essential to operate in and maintain a team environment. Great communication skills and ability to follow instructions. EDUCATION / EXPERIENCE: High school diploma or equivalent. 0-1 year of experience in an administrative support role preferred.
